Home Free!

Home Free! is a 1964 one-act play by American playwright Lanford Wilson. It was first produced at Caffe Cino, a coffeehouse and small theatre run by Joseph Cino, a pioneer of the Off-Off-Broadway theatre movement. It is one of Wilson's earliest plays.
